As a QA Manager at GoGuardian, you will have the opportunity to support and help launch new features across multiple teams. You will be responsible for developing and documenting strategies for testing, executing the strategies, and implementing automation. You will also help shape best practices across the company and be an advocate for quality assurance in development. As a QA Manager, you will play a key role in shaping our products from the early stages of development. We are looking for someone with excellent communication skills to be able to provide clear and concise feedback to our teams.
Here's what you will be doing:
● Test planning, test design, test development and automation
● Manage a team of QA Engineers
● Provide feedback and insight from a Quality Assurance standpoint on new features in development
● Track quality assurance metrics, like defect densities and open defect counts
● Bug tracking reporting, reviewing and analyzing test results
● Automate testing of our products and help shape our CI/CD pipelines
● Perform Quality Assurance duties across multiple teams
● Should be willing to work in a very fluid startup environment and take complete ownership of
the assigned responsibility
Requirements:
● 8+ years of experience in Quality Assurance
● Experience in leading and managing team
● Should be self-driven and self-motivated with great communication and presentation skills
● Comfortable working in the Scrum process
● Extensive experience with any of the end to end testing frameworks like Cypress or Selenium
● Have experience and understanding of programming languages like Java or Javascript for testing purposes
● AWS platform knowledge and familiarity in database testing and competence in SQL
